Amazon Games and Crystal Dynamics have announced that they have reached an agreement under which Crystal Dynamics will develop a new Tomb Raider title, with Amazon Games providing full support and publishing the game globally.

The title is in early development, but Amazon Games and Crystal Dynamics can confirm at this time that the new Tomb Raider is a single-player, narrative-driven adventure that is being developed using Unreal Engine 5 and coming to multiple platforms.

It is also being described as the most expansive game in the series to date.

The as-yet-untitled new Tomb Raider game is a single-player, narrative-driven adventure that continues Lara Croft’s story in the Tomb Raider series. It includes all the elements that have made Tomb Raider one of the most revered franchises in gaming, giving players control of the confident and multidimensional hero Lara Croft in an environment that rewards exploration and creative pathfinding, with mind-bending puzzles to solve, and a wide variety of enemies to face and overcome. Crystal Dynamics is drawing on the power and cutting-edge technology of Unreal Engine 5 to take storytelling to the next level, in the biggest, most expansive Tomb Raider game to date. The title is currently in early development, and additional details will be announced at a later date.

“Tomb Raider is one of the most beloved IPs in entertainment history,” said Christoph Hartmann, VP of Amazon Games. “Amazon Games is committed to bringing players games of the highest quality, from the best developers, across all variety of platforms and genres, and we’re honored by the opportunity to work with this storied developer and franchise. Our team is incredibly excited about collaborating with the talented and visionary Crystal Dynamics team to bring the next chapter of Lara Croft’s saga to players around the world.”

“Crystal Dynamics has an extraordinary opportunity following our acquisition by Embracer to redefine what a publishing relationship is for Tomb Raider,” said Scot Amos, head of studio at Crystal Dynamics. “Transformative is what we’re looking for, and with Amazon Games, we found a team that shares our creative vision, ambitions, and values for a Lara Croft universe across the spectrum of possibilities. They’re uniquely positioned to rewrite what publishing and development collaborations are, and we’re eager to forge this new path together, starting with building the biggest and best Tomb Raider game yet!”

Crystal Dynamics confirmed that it was developing a new Tomb Raider game in April 2022, delivering a video during Epic Games’ State of Unreal 2022 event that revealed the next installment would leverage Unreal Engine 5.

Tomb Raider and Rise of the Tomb Raider, the first two games in the reboot trilogy, were developed by Crystal Dynamics, while the third game, Shadow of the Tomb Raider, was handled by Deus Ex studio Eidos-Montréal.

The Tomb Raider franchise has sold more than 95 million copies since its first entry, which released for the original PlayStation console in 1996.

The new Tomb Raider title marks Amazon Games’ first single-player narrative title.
